Sandstone Arrives Special Delivery

Eyebrows were raised yesterday when the good folk of Middlewich saw this large slab of sandstone being delivered to Salinae field. The sandstone will be used to create a lasting monument for Middlewich, carved with images depicting the area’s boating heritage by Cheshire stone carving artist, Andrew Worthington.
